Updated: 1:17 p.m. June 7
First discovered: Less than an hour ago, 12:45 p.m. June 7
Initial location: Nevada County, Calif.
Fire type: Wildfire
Fire name: Ground
Ground Fire initially started today at 12:45 p.m. in in Nevada County, California.
Since its discovery less than an hour ago, it has burned four acres of private land, an increase of four acres since the last update. Currently, there is no information on the containment of the fire and the cause of it is still undetermined.
Source: National Interagency Fire Center
